- The distance between Rome, Italy and Wichita Falls, Tx, Usa is approximately 9,031 km or 5,612 mi.
- To reach Rome in this distance one would set out from Wichita Falls, Tx bearing 44.6°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Rome bearing 128.4° or SE .
- Rome has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Wichita Falls, Tx has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Rome is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ome whereas Wichita Falls, Tx is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
- The mean temperature is 2.1 °C (3.7°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.2 °C (14.8°F) less in Rome.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 103.2 mm (4.1 in) more which is equivalent to 103.2 l/m² (2.53 US gal/ft²) or 1,032,000 l/ha (110,328 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7.9° lower in Rome than in Wichita Falls, Tx.
